This Week in History (T.W.I.H.)
As part of this class, you will select a week to change the display case to show your peers what happened that week in American history.

Things to remember...
- Please do not do "_________ was born" on this day for your events. If you look a little harder, you'll find better options.
- For this project, your choices should reflect AMERICAN history, not world history.
- Try to find fascinating events that your fellow students may have heard of.
- Get your dates and facts right! Double-check before you put it in the display case.
- Spelling is important. If there's a misspelling, it's not good enough for the display case.
- When you're putting up your papers in the display case, be careful with the glass doors. Don't rush! Use the push pins to line up your paper with the permanent white paper that's permanently stapled in the display case.
- All four pictures/text pages should be formatted the same. Recommended formatting is below.
